@import "https://fonts.googleapis.com/css2?family=Poppins:wght@300;400;500;600;700;800;900&display=swap";:root{--font-heading:"Poppins", sans-serif;--font-body:"Poppins", sans-serif;--green-50:#ecfdf5;--green-100:#d1fae5;--green-200:#a7f3d0;--green-300:#6ee7b7;--green-400:#34d399;--green-500:#00b35c;--green-600:#009e50;--green-700:#058554;--green-800:#046a43;--green-900:#035234;--bg-main:#f4f6f9;--bg-surface:#ffffffd9;--bg-surface-solid:#fff;--bg-surface-hover:#ebf0f5;--bg-input:#ebf0f5;--bg-card:#ffffffb3;--bg-elevated:#fff;--accent:#ff6b00;--accent-light:#ff8522;--accent-glow:#ff6b001a;--accent-gradient:linear-gradient(135deg, #ff8522 0%, #ff6b00 50%, #e05300 100%);--accent-gradient-h:linear-gradient(90deg, #ff8522 0%, #ffa04d 100%);--accent-gradient-soft:linear-gradient(135deg, #ff6b0014 0%, #ff852208 100%);--border-color:#0f172a14;--border-focus:#ff6b0066;--border-glow:#ff6b0026;--text-primary:#0f172a;--text-secondary:#475569;--text-muted:#64748b;--text-accent:#ff6b00;--shadow-sm:0 1px 3px #0f172a0a;--shadow-md:0 4px 12px #0f172a0f;--shadow-lg:0 8px 30px #0f172a1a;--shadow-glow:0 0 20px #ff6b000d;--brand-orange:#ff6b00;--transition-smooth:all .3s cubic-bezier(.16, 1, .3, 1);--transition-bounce:all .4s cubic-bezier(.34, 1.56, .64, 1);--radius-sm:8px;--radius-md:12px;--radius-lg:16px;--radius-xl:20px;--radius-full:9999px}*{box-sizing:border-box;margin:0;padding:0}body{background-color:var(--bg-main);color:var(--text-primary);font-family:var(--font-body);-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;background-image:radial-gradient(at 20% 0,#00b35c08 0%,#0000 50%),radial-gradient(at 80% 100%,#00b35c05 0%,#0000 50%);min-height:100vh;line-height:1.5}::-webkit-scrollbar{width:4px;height:4px}::-webkit-scrollbar-track{background:0 0}::-webkit-scrollbar-thumb{background:#0f172a14;border-radius:4px}::-webkit-scrollbar-thumb:hover{background:var(--accent)}.glass-panel{background:var(--bg-surface);-webkit-backdrop-filter:blur(20px);border:1px solid var(--border-color);border-radius:var(--radius-lg);transition:var(--transition-smooth)}.glass-panel:hover{border-color:var(--border-glow)}.btn{border-radius:var(--radius-md);font-family:var(--font-body);cursor:pointer;transition:var(--transition-smooth);color:#fff;letter-spacing:.02em;border:none;outline:none;justify-content:center;align-items:center;gap:8px;padding:12px 20px;font-size:.85rem;font-weight:600;display:inline-flex;position:relative;overflow:hidden}.btn:after{content:"";opacity:0;background:linear-gradient(#ffffff1a 0%,#0000 50%);transition:opacity .3s;position:absolute;inset:0}.btn:hover:after{opacity:1}.btn-primary{background:var(--accent-gradient);color:#fff;box-shadow:0 4px 15px #00d26a40}.btn-primary:hover{transform:translateY(-2px);box-shadow:0 8px 25px #00d26a59}.btn-primary:active{transform:translateY(0)}.btn-gold{background:var(--accent-gradient);color:#fff;box-shadow:0 4px 15px #00d26a40}.btn-gold:hover{transform:translateY(-2px);box-shadow:0 8px 25px #00d26a59}.btn-secondary{color:var(--text-secondary);-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);background:#0f172a0d;border:1px solid #0f172a14}.btn-secondary:hover{color:var(--text-primary);background:#0f172a14;border-color:#0f172a1f}.btn-danger{color:#ef4444;background:#ef44441a;border:1px solid #ef444433}.btn-danger:hover{background:#ef444433;border-color:#ef44444d}.form-group{flex-direction:column;gap:6px;margin-bottom:18px;display:flex}.form-label{font-family:var(--font-body);color:var(--text-secondary);text-transform:uppercase;letter-spacing:.06em;font-size:.75rem;font-weight:600}.form-input{background:var(--bg-input);border:1px solid var(--border-color);border-radius:var(--radius-md);width:100%;color:var(--text-primary);font-family:var(--font-body);transition:var(--transition-smooth);outline:none;padding:12px 16px;font-size:.9rem}.form-input:focus{border-color:var(--accent);box-shadow:0 0 0 3px #00d26a1a}.form-input::placeholder{color:var(--text-muted)}.header-container{width:100%;max-width:480px;margin:0 auto}@keyframes fadeIn{0%{opacity:0;transform:translateY(10px)}to{opacity:1;transform:translateY(0)}}@keyframes slideUp{0%{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}}@keyframes slideDown{0%{opacity:0;transform:translateY(-10px)}to{opacity:1;transform:translateY(0)}}@keyframes pulse{0%,to{opacity:1}50%{opacity:.7}}@keyframes shimmer{0%{background-position:-200% 0}to{background-position:200% 0}}@keyframes glow{0%,to{box-shadow:0 0 15px #00d26a26}50%{box-shadow:0 0 30px #00d26a40}}.animate-fade-in{animation:.4s cubic-bezier(.16,1,.3,1) forwards fadeIn}.animate-slide-up{animation:.5s cubic-bezier(.16,1,.3,1) forwards slideUp}.mobile-wrapper{background:var(--bg-main);background-image:radial-gradient(at 50% 0,#00d26a08 0%,#0000 60%);border-left:1px solid #00d26a0d;border-right:1px solid #00d26a0d;flex-direction:column;max-width:480px;min-height:100vh;margin:0 auto;display:flex;position:relative;box-shadow:0 0 80px #000c}.flip-card{perspective:1000px;width:100%;height:190px;margin-bottom:20px}.flip-card-inner{text-align:center;width:100%;height:100%;transform-style:preserve-3d;transition:transform .6s cubic-bezier(.4,0,.2,1);position:relative}.flip-card.flipped .flip-card-inner{transform:rotateY(180deg)}.flip-card-front,.flip-card-back{backface-visibility:hidden;border-radius:var(--radius-lg);flex-direction:column;justify-content:space-between;width:100%;height:100%;padding:20px;display:flex;position:absolute}.flip-card-front{border:1px solid var(--border-color);color:#fff;background:linear-gradient(135deg,#0f172a 0%,#060b14 100%)}.flip-card-back{border:1px solid var(--border-color);color:#fff;background:linear-gradient(135deg,#060b14 0%,#0f172a 100%);justify-content:space-around;transform:rotateY(180deg)}.stat-card{background:var(--bg-surface);-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);border:1px solid var(--border-color);border-radius:var(--radius-lg);text-align:left;transition:var(--transition-smooth);align-items:center;gap:14px;padding:16px;display:flex}.stat-card:hover{border-color:var(--border-glow);box-shadow:var(--shadow-glow)}.stat-icon{border-radius:var(--radius-md);flex-shrink:0;justify-content:center;align-items:center;width:42px;height:42px;display:flex}.bottom-nav{border-top:1px solid var(--border-color);background:var(--bg-surface);-webkit-backdrop-filter:blur(20px);display:flex}.bottom-nav-btn{cursor:pointer;transition:var(--transition-smooth);background:0 0;border:none;flex-direction:column;flex:1;align-items:center;gap:4px;padding:14px 0 12px;display:flex;position:relative}.bottom-nav-btn:before{content:"";background:var(--accent);border-radius:0 0 2px 2px;width:0;height:2px;transition:width .3s;position:absolute;top:0;left:50%;transform:translate(-50%)}.bottom-nav-btn.active:before{width:32px}.bottom-nav-btn .nav-label{letter-spacing:.04em;font-size:.68rem;font-weight:600;transition:color .3s}.badge{border-radius:var(--radius-full);align-items:center;gap:4px;padding:4px 10px;font-size:.7rem;font-weight:600;display:inline-flex}.badge-green{color:var(--accent);background:#ff6b0014;border:1px solid #ff6b0026}.badge-red{color:#ef4444;background:#ef44441a;border:1px solid #ef444426}.badge-muted{color:var(--text-secondary);background:#94a3b814;border:1px solid #94a3b81a}
